Had the bongo since end of season last year and no problems until today, after a 40 min drive it failed to restart after being turn off for 5 minutes. No dash light at all and no cranking of the engine. Tried jumping off my work van too but nothing. Changed 100a fuse no change.
I think it points to a flat battery (new 5 months ago but on charge as I type) but cant jump it and surely dash lights would light up even if there dim but nothing at all.
Headlights/wipers/indicators were working
Heating module on dash lights up but when I turn the ignition key to position 2 to start/crank it turns off completly.
Seen a few posts regarding the solenoid in the starter motor could need replacing but would still see dashboard lights?
No alarm or immobiliser installed but the leisure battery seems to drain quite quickly, thought it was the new head unit so installed a seperate rocker on/off switch.
